Community Profile

Wdm has a median household income of $84,588. It is a well-educated community where 49%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$267,600, with a median rent of $1,065/month. The local poverty rate of 7.4% is relatively low. Residents enjoy a short average commute of 18 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.

How does MySchoolScout rate schools in Wdm, Iowa?

MySchoolScout rates schools using publicly available data from the NCES Common Core of Data and state education departments. Each school receives a 1-10 composite score built from Student Growth, Poverty-Adjusted Academic Achievement, and School Environment — plus College Readiness for high schools. Weights vary by school level, and equity data is shown for context but not scored.
